python做3d游戏
时间: 2023-10-30 12:28:11 浏览: 92
太空工程师 根据三维模型生成符合游戏要求的三维外壳
在 Python 中做 3D 游戏的方法有很多,常用的游戏引擎有 Pygame、Panda3D、Cocos2d、pyglet 等。它们都可以用来制作 3D 游戏。
Pygame 是一个用于游戏开发的 Python 库,它是在 SDL 上进行了封装,支持 2D 图形和音频。如果只是简单的 3D 游戏,Pygame 可能是一个不错的选择。
Panda3D 是一个用于 3D 游戏和应用程序开发的引擎。它提供了一个高性能的 3D 渲染器和一个友好的 API,可以轻松地在 Python 中制作 3D 游戏。
Cocos2d 是一个高性能的 2D 游戏引擎,支持 Python 和其他语言,可以用来制作 2D 游戏。
pyglet是一个面向对象的跨平台OpenGL游戏库,可以编写2D和3D游戏,并且可以结合像pymunk这样的物理库进行2D游戏的开发。
这些库都有很多资源可供学习,可以根据自己的需求来选择使用。
阅读全文